4/5/2023 0 Comments Gitx github toolWhile Copilot's suggestions are "pretty accurate," using the tool can be a double-edged sword because it's easy to trust it too much, Ghazanfar said, which means the developer must go back and correct errors when the suggested code doesn't work.Įven former GitHub CEO Nat Friedman, who oversaw Copilot's launch, has spoken about the product's flaws. "That was a bunch of typing, a bunch of thinking, I didn't have to do," Mers said. Occasionally, he writes comments inside his code explaining to other engineers what exactly the scripts were designed to do, and Copilot can pick up on that and do it for him, writing human-language descriptions of exactly what the code is doing. Mers estimated that Copilot had saved him 10% of the time he would've normally spent coding. Copilot gleans its knowledge from the large corpus of projects on GitHub, but it also uses the context of the project an engineer is working on to suggest tailored code. Ghazanfar said he could now use Copilot to build a database with these properties.īill Mers, the vice president of engineering at LookDeep Health, said it's "almost creepy" when Copilot figured out exactly what code he's trying to write. "I find Copilot super useful because there's a lot of repetition when you do these kinds of things."įor example, many databases have the same properties, like a timestamp that says when the data was created. "In these frameworks, there's a specific way of creating databases," Ghazanfar said. Already, Copilot has proved useful for creating databases, he said. He now requires his team of three engineers to use the tool because he quickly found it saved him plenty of time by eliminating rote work. Engineers who spoke with Insider said it had already proved a major boon for productivity.Ĭopilot can help developers become more productiveĬyrus Ghazanfar, the chief technology officer at the 401(k)-management startup Beagle, said his company began experimenting with Copilot in recent months. GitHub has said that in files where it's enabled, Copilot is responsible for upward of 40% of the written code. Because the code is so common, Copilot can easily reproduce it. Software engineers often have to put together scaffolding, or boilerplate code software needs think the outline of an essay. Users can also write a comment in human language describing the program they want to build, and Copilot will provide a suggested solution. Copilot looks at the code an engineer is writing and suggests the next few lines they might want to write to solve their problem. The Microsoft-backed company has developed a slew of generative-AI products, including one called Codex that's already helping engineers become more productive.Ĭodex is the basis for GitHub Copilot, a tool that functions as a sort of autocomplete for software engineers. While ChatGPT has spurred a lot of excitement around generative AI, the conversational chatbot is not the only technology to come from OpenAI. Account icon An icon in the shape of a person's head and shoulders.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|